Buying Guide for the Best Cube Ice Machines

Choosing the right cube ice machine can be a bit overwhelming, but with the right approach, you can find the perfect fit for your needs. Cube ice machines are essential for various settings, including restaurants, bars, and even home use. The key is to understand your specific requirements and match them with the machine's capabilities. Here are some important specifications to consider when selecting a cube ice machine.
Ice Production CapacityIce production capacity refers to the amount of ice a machine can produce in a 24-hour period. This is crucial because it determines whether the machine can meet your daily ice needs. Ice production capacities can range from as low as 20 pounds per day to over 1,000 pounds per day. For home use or small offices, a machine with a lower capacity (20-50 pounds) might be sufficient. For larger establishments like restaurants or bars, you might need a machine that produces 200 pounds or more per day. Assess your daily ice consumption to choose the right capacity.
Ice Storage CapacityIce storage capacity is the amount of ice the machine can hold at any given time. This is important because it ensures you have a reserve of ice ready for use, especially during peak times. Storage capacities can vary widely, from small bins holding 10 pounds to large bins holding several hundred pounds. If you have fluctuating ice needs or expect high demand periods, opt for a machine with a larger storage capacity. For consistent, low-demand use, a smaller storage capacity will suffice.
Ice Cube Size and ShapeIce cube size and shape can affect the cooling efficiency and aesthetic appeal of your drinks. Common shapes include full cubes, half cubes, and gourmet cubes. Full cubes are larger and melt slowly, making them ideal for cocktails and spirits. Half cubes are smaller and melt faster, suitable for soft drinks and blended beverages. Gourmet cubes are often used in upscale settings for their visual appeal. Consider the type of beverages you serve and choose the ice shape that complements them best.
Machine TypeCube ice machines come in different types, including modular, undercounter, and countertop models. Modular machines are large and designed to sit on top of ice storage bins or beverage dispensers, making them suitable for high-volume needs. Undercounter machines are compact and fit under standard countertops, ideal for bars or small kitchens. Countertop machines are portable and convenient for small spaces or occasional use. Determine the space you have available and the volume of ice you need to decide on the right type.
Energy EfficiencyEnergy efficiency is an important consideration for both environmental and cost reasons. Energy-efficient ice machines consume less electricity and water, reducing your utility bills and environmental footprint. Look for machines with Energy Star certification, which indicates they meet specific energy-saving standards. If you use the machine frequently, investing in an energy-efficient model can lead to significant savings over time.
Ease of MaintenanceEase of maintenance is crucial for the longevity and performance of your ice machine. Regular cleaning and maintenance prevent the buildup of scale and bacteria, ensuring the ice remains clean and safe. Some machines come with self-cleaning features or easy-to-remove parts that simplify the maintenance process. Consider how much time and effort you can dedicate to maintenance and choose a machine that aligns with your capabilities.
